1.16 HYDRAULIC SYSTEM Continued.
1.16.13 Mobile Mode, Internal Power, Vent Mode, Full NBC.
The principle difference between the MOBILE and Static Modes is that in the Mobile Mode, the rotating
ECU components, vent (NBC) and recirculation fans, compressor, etc., operate at approximately 1/2 speed.
The slower speed is required because of the reduced volume that requires NBC protection or cooling. The
LMS is much smaller than the combination of the LMS and the ABS that is required in the static mode. This
is accomplished by the hydraulic manifold input solenoid switching from solenoid valve SV2 to solenoid valve
SV1 for the mobile mode. This in turn brings flow control FP1 into the circuit which is set at approximately
1/2 flow. The balance of the hydraulic circuit remains the same as static mode.
